Jones Beach West End, Massapequa

I stopped by the Jones Beach West End today - lots of Robins, Starlings, and Red-winged Blackbirds. There were a decent amount of Flickers and 4 Killdeer were in the median by the booth. Also saw 2 Phoebes. At the Coast Guard Station, there were at least 6 Horned Grebes - some with great plumage. Common Loons and Long Tailed Ducks were still present. A lone Oystercatcher was on the sandbar that leads to "the Spit".  By the Coast Guard gates, a group of ~10 Cedar Waxwings landed in the trees.

At Massapequa Preserve, the red morph Screech Owl was visible. I saw a pair of Brown Headed Cowbirds there and a pair has been hanging out by the bird feeder in my yard all day.
